Tips for making the most out of video comms in aged care

Published

Bandwidth, back-up and brilliant staff are among the key ingredients of successful video conferencing in aged care, writes Natasha Egan.

The spread and threat of coronavirus is seeing a huge increase in the use of a particular technology application by aged care organisations around the country. Video calls. For both in-house meetings and keeping residents and family members connected, aged care is ramping up its use of video conferencing technologies.

Among them is New South Wales provider SummitCare, which uses a Google platform across its business plus iPads at each facility for residents to use for communication and activities.
